This past weekend over 4,000 actors met at Hammerstein Ballroom on 34th Street in NYC for the annual Actorfest 2010. This was a great opportunity for beginners and seasoned professionals to participate in casting calls, “Meet and Drop” with popular casting directors, and to attend workshops hosted by industry professionals. Dozens of photographers, acting teachers, plus products and services were available in a huge, but cramp exhibit hall. Attendees were able to get information about headshots, auditions and callbacks, and learned all the new media, including: websites, podcasts, and DVD demo reels.
